Justin Moore

Justin Moore's success in country music is reminiscent of times gone by. The Arkansas native is one of the very few hat acts left among the younger country crop, with influences that encompass both classic country and rock. He released his debut single, 'Back That Thing Up,' in 2008, but it wasn't until 2009 that he scored his breakthrough with 'Small Town USA,' which gave him his first No. 1 hit. His self-titled debut album went Gold, as did his sophomore effort, 2011's 'Outlaws Like Me,' which placed additional hit singles including 'Bait a Hook,' 'Til My Last Day' and 'If Heaven Wasn't So Far Away,' another chart-topper. 2013 saw the release of Moore's third studio album, 'Off the Beaten Path,' which scored even more hits with 'Point at You' and 'Lettin' the Night Roll.' Moore is also a devoted family man, and with the birth of his third child in 2014, he announced his intention to scale back his touring activities and spend more time at home.

  • Full Name: Justin Cole Moore
  • Top Songs: ‘Small Town USA,’ ‘If Heaven Wasn’t So Far Away’
  • Did You Know? Moore and his family live in the tiny town of Poyen, Ark.

Justin Moore to Embark on Outlaws Like Me Headline Tour in March
Justin Moore to Embark on Outlaws Like Me Headline Tour in March
Justin Moore to Embark on Outlaws Like Me Headline Tour in March
Justin Moore is taking his outlaw show on the road. The singer will embark on his first-ever headline tour on March 14. The tour, dubbed Outlaws Like Me, will feature support from Dustin Lynch and John Pardi. The first show takes place in Pikeville, Ky. and runs through April 20, wrapping in Corbin, Ky. Full circle!
